How Weather Affects Breakdown Recovery in Milton Keynes

Breakdown recovery is an essential service for drivers in Milton Keynes, where weather conditions can often be unpredictable. From colder winter days to rainy spells and occasional warm summer days, varying weather conditions can significantly affect the efficiency of breakdown recovery services in Milton Keynes. In this post, we explore how different weather conditions impact breakdown and recovery efforts and how motorists can be better prepared.


The Impact of Adverse Weather on Breakdown Recovery

Weather conditions in Milton Keynes can significantly influence the demand and timing of breakdown recovery services. Adverse weather, such as cold snaps, rain, and occasional warm days, increases the likelihood of vehicle breakdowns. Recovery teams often face longer response times due to slower traffic, slippery roads, and reduced visibility during these conditions.


Winter Weather Challenges

Milton Keynes experiences cold winters, making breakdown recovery more challenging. Snow, ice, and freezing temperatures are common, leading to increased vehicle breakdowns. Some typical issues motorists face include:

  1. Cold starts due to battery failure in sub-zero temperatures.
  2. Engine problems caused by frozen fluids like coolant and oil.
  3. Skidding or sliding on icy roads, resulting in accidents.


In such conditions, breakdown recovery teams in Milton Keynes must take extra care, as icy roads require cautious driving to prevent further damage to vehicles. Icy conditions can also delay recovery vehicles, making it harder to reach stranded motorists promptly.


Rain and Localised Flooding

Milton Keynes experiences frequent rainfall, particularly during the autumn and winter months. While heavy downpours that lead to widespread flooding are not common, localised flooding can occur in certain low-lying areas, especially during periods of intense rainfall. This can cause temporary road closures and traffic disruptions, affecting breakdown recovery services. Typical issues during rainy conditions include:

  1. Reduced tyre grip, increasing the risk of skidding.
  2. Ponding on roads, making access to certain areas more challenging.
  3. Engine stalling, particularly if drivers attempt to navigate through deep puddles.


The city’s infrastructure is generally well-equipped to manage moderate rainfall, but extreme weather events can still lead to temporary delays for recovery teams. During periods of heavy rain, motorists should remain cautious and be aware of potential localised flooding that may disrupt road conditions.


Heat and Warm Temperatures

While Milton Keynes isn’t known for extreme heat, it can still feel hot during the summer when temperatures reach the mid-20s Celsius (mid-70s Fahrenheit). Though this may not seem high compared to other regions, it is considered warm by UK standards, especially for those not accustomed to such temperatures. During heatwaves or periods of prolonged warm weather, temperatures can peak between 25°C and 28°C. Typical issues during warm conditions include:

  1. Engine overheating, particularly in slow-moving traffic or on longer drives.
  2. Tyre pressure changes, as warmer road surfaces can increase tyre pressure.
  3. Battery strain, since warmer conditions can reduce battery efficiency.


Despite being mild compared to global standards, such temperatures can still lead to breakdowns. Car breakdown recovery teams in Milton Keynes are prepared to handle these heat-related challenges, carrying the necessary equipment to address overheating and ensuring safety during recovery operations.


Fog and Reduced Visibility

Fog is common in Milton Keynes, especially during autumn and winter, significantly reducing visibility and increasing the risk of accidents. Common issues in foggy conditions include:

  1. Misjudged distances, leading to accidents and breakdowns.
  2. Reduced visibility, making recovery efforts slower and more cautious.


Recovery operators must use high-visibility clothing, hazard lights, and fog lamps during such conditions, which can slow response times but ensure safety.


How to Prepare for Weather-Related Breakdowns

While weather is beyond control, motorists in Milton Keynes can take several steps to minimise breakdown risks:

  1. Regular vehicle maintenance, especially before extreme weather conditions.
  2. Checking tyres, battery, brakes, and fluids to ensure they are in good condition.
  3. Keeping emergency supplies in the car, such as blankets, a torch, a first aid kit, water, and a fully charged mobile phone.


By taking these precautions, drivers can reduce the likelihood of a breakdown and stay safer on the road during unpredictable weather.
